Art Lilley Campground

The off-highway vehicle (OHV) trail system in the Uwharrie offers a variety of topography and scenery. All trails are designated for all off-highway vehicles and marked with orange diamonds. Stay on the designated trail system to help prevent soil erosion and creek sedimentation, which occur as a result of illegal trail use. FS roads cannot be used as trail connectors, but all vehicles operating on the road system must be "street legal" meaning that the vehicles are fully licensed, inspected and registered.  Persons violating these regulations will be fined according to the law. NCDOT approved helmets and eye protection are required. The trail system is subject to a seasonal closure during the winter months (from Dec. 15 - April 1) in order to prevent unacceptable soil erosion and stream sedimentation.  Trail passes are also required for all vehicles on the OHV trails.

Dispersed camping is allowed around this area. Also RV's and campers are allowed in the area, there are no hook ups or water available on site, but there is a vault toilet available.

The OHV trail system is open from April 1 to Dec 15, annually. It is open 24 hours a day and 7 days a week. A daily trail pass is good until midnight of the day of purchase. An annual pass can also be purchased, which is good for the entire season. You can night ride as long as you have working headlights, brake lights and a spark arrester.

There is no fee to camp at Art Lilley Campground. You just need to make sure you have a vaild trail pass.
